    COULD GIANTS PICKS GET DUNKLEY TO LIONS?

    Brisbane and Greater Western Sydney have agreed on a deal that could help the Lions’ pursuit of Western Bulldogs midfielder Josh Dunkley.

    News Corp can reveal the Lions were shopping pick 15 to rival clubs and have found a trade partner in the Giants, who will send them No.21 and a future second-round selection in return.

    The trade is awaiting AFL approval but is expected to get the green light.

    Brisbane now has more flexibility to trade future picks, with league rules preventing clubs from trading a future first and second-round selection unless they bring an extra one in.

    The Bulldogs want two first-round picks from the Lions for Dunkley.
